What companies run services between Raleigh, NC, USA and Richmond, VA, USA?

Greyhound USA operates a bus from Raleigh Bus Station to Richmond hourly. Tickets cost $22–45 and the journey takes 2h 35m. Flixbus USA also services this route 5 times a day.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a train from Raleigh Union Station to Richmond Staples Mill Road Amtrak Station twice daily. Tickets cost $60–130 and the journey takes 3h 26m.
